Bhubaneswar: To ensure smooth conduct of COVID-19 vaccination in Odisha, the state government has decided to conduct dry run in all the districts from Friday.
Briefing mediapersons after presiding over a high-level review meeting, additional chief secretary, Health & Family Welfare Pradipta Mohapatra said that the dry run will be conducted in sub-divisional hospitals, community health centres (CHC) in all the districts from 10 am to 12 pm.
The dry run will also be held in Medical College & Hospital, urban primary health centres (UPHC) and urban community health centres (UCHC) and a large medical college and hospital in districts where they are available, he added.
Mohapatra further said that in case there are any side effects of the vaccine, the session sites will have the AEFI (Adverse Events Following Immunization) kits.
